This with an Asi 178 osc, 12" SCT & 2x 2" powermate.
Stack with 30% of 5,000 frames @ 50fps
Results from stack were needing experimentation, particularly with Alignment Point sizes in AS!2 - I found if too small, it produced some wavery wiggles in the darker edge zones, but found they all but disappeared with alling point sizes around 50 pixels ?
Anywho, I am even happier with this, compared to the recent previous image.
It looks a little dark and blotchy from the limb to half way in, but I think this is just 'low signal' details trying to express themselves,,, which tend to present better with a darker 'zoning' histogram ?
